Skip to content

Releases: SAP/theming-base-content

11.12.1

28 Feb 12:21

Choose a tag to compare

Bug Fixes

  • Design Tokens for shadows without a blur (like @sapContent_HeaderShadow: inset 0 -0.125rem @sapObjectHeader_BorderColor) are exported correctly

v11.12.0

14 Feb 14:56

Choose a tag to compare

Features

  • 18 new parameters in the new sapAssistant_… namespace that describe the SAP cross technology digital assistant, currently named Joule
  • New parameter sapShell_Assistant_ForegroundColor that describes the foreground color of the SAP assistant within the shell bar

v11.11.0

01 Feb 11:40

Choose a tag to compare

Features

  • Font 72 v1.40 with added support for Bulgarian characters. Bulgarian Cyrillic alternates are accessible through the OpenType feature LOCL > Bulgarian

v11.10.0

18 Dec 12:06

Choose a tag to compare

Features

  • SAP-icons-TNT v3.5 and v2.10 with new icons e10e (fiori-application) and e10f (build-code)

Bug Fixes

  • A light blue sapButton_Selected_Background and a darker blue sapButton_Selecter_Hover_Background in Morning Horizon make unselected Toggle Buttons distinguishable from regular Buttons
  • The handle icons of positive (sapButton_Handle_Positive_TextColor) and negative (sapButton_Handle_Negative_TextColor) Switches have an increased contrast by defaulting to sapTextColor in high-contrast themes
  • The value and "maximum" dot of Progress elements (sapProgress_Value_Background) have an increased contrast against the bar color in Morning and Evening Horizon
  • Morning Horizon is the fallback theme for the Base framework
  • The labels of high-contrast themes now adhere to SAPs naming guideline of using "SAP" only in front of branded terms, with an exception for the beginnings of theme labels, i.e. they are now labeled "SAP High Contrast Black (Horizon)" instead of "SAP High Contrast Black (SAP Horizon)" and similar
  • contrast() statements of sapIndicationColor_…_Active_TextColor now reference sapIndicationColor_…_Active_Background as their background in Quartz Light and Dark

v11.9.0

07 Nov 16:24

Choose a tag to compare

Features

  • SAP-icons-TNT v3.4 and v2.9 with new icon e10d (bound-validation-rule)

Bug Fixes

  • SAP-icons-TNT v3.4 and v2.9 with redesigned icon e07c (network)

v11.8.0

25 Oct 08:53

Choose a tag to compare

Features

  • Icon metadata for the SAP-icons-TNT font in Base/baseLib/baseTheme/fonts/SAP-icons-TNT.json
  • SAP-icons v5.7 and v4.19 with new icon e2a5 (ai)

Bug Fixes

  • SAP-icons v5.7 and v4.19 with updated metaphors for e2a3 (da) and e2a4 (da-2), as well as e01a (pdf-attachment) and e0ce (pdf-reader) without adobe shape

v11.7.0

17 Oct 06:20

Choose a tag to compare

Features

  • Icon metadata for the SAP-icons font in Base/baseLib/baseTheme/fonts/SAP-icons.json
  • SAP-icons v5.06 and v4.18 with new icons for the Digital Assistant: e2a3 (da) and e2a4 (da-2)
  • SAP-icons-TNT v3.3 and v2.8 with new icons for AI: e10b (ai-1) and e10c (ai-2)
  • Design Tokens of theming parameters (e.g. sapField_Background, but not _sapField_BackgroundH etc.) now contain the description of the parameter

Bug Fixes

  • SAP-icons v5.06 and v4.18 with metaphors in v5 aligned to v4 for e1fd (sort-ascending), e1fc (sort-descending), e080 (database), e0b1 (message-error), e202 (message-information), e203 (message-success) and e201 (message-warning)
  • The design-tokens for sapField_…Background, sapField_…HelpBackground and sapField_Hover_…Shadow now have a usable value.

v11.6.8

11 Sep 10:57

Choose a tag to compare

This is the release that brings the updated parameter values for the Horizon theme family that we announced with 11.3.0 (on 2023-04-04). It is synced with the major SAP UI technologies (UI5 WebComponents, SAPUI5, and Unified Rendering) and should not cause breaking changes. Hence, as it fixes design bugs, it is considered a bug fix.

Bug Fixes

  • Hundreds of parameters of Morning and Evening Horizon are updated based on one year of customer feedback. See Improvements Coming to the Horizon Visual Theme for SAP Fiori for a detailed explanation. Main changes are:
    • editable Fields are white again, and read-only fields grey (only with @sapField_HorizonNGEnabled: 1, which defaults to 0 for base.less and to 1 for css_variables.less)
    • shadows with a spread are no longer used
    • Hover states are more visible
    • standard Buttons look more enabled now and a light blue (secondary information) Button is introduced

v11.6.7

07 Sep 12:49

Choose a tag to compare

Bug Fixes

  • @font-face definitions of "commonly used subset" fonts (e.g. "72", not "72full") no longer contain Combining Characters (like U+30C, the "Combining Caron") in a followup of https://crbug.com/1444391
  • A fixed build of BusinessSuiteInAppSymbols v2.084 with updated glyphs of e0e3 (business-partner), e08a (face-astonished), e087 (face-bad) and e086 (face-very-bad)
  • Chart colors (sapChart_…) have an increased contrast against sapBackgroundColor in Morning and Evening Horizon
  • sapIndicationColor_1 is #fd4444 in Evening Horizon as an accessibility enhancement
  • Tags and Types of some parameters are adapted, to improve the parameter visualization in the Theme Designer UI; e.g. actual images like sapCompanyLogo have the type image, the sapShell_Category_…_TextShadow parameters now have the type boxShadow, or the sapField_…BorderStyle parameters have the type borderStyle
  • Design Tokens more closely reflect the less version of the theming-base-content, especially where fade(…) and contrast(…) is used in less

v11.6.4

02 Aug 11:16

Choose a tag to compare

Bug Fixes

  • sapHC_HighlightBackground has been slightly darkened in Quartz HCB, Belize HCB, and HCB (to the value used in Horizon HCB) to achieve an AAA (7:1) contrast against white